Vav Jungle - Zig-a-dig
(Kidnap Hairdo, 1997)
Formed in 1990 to
create "an artistic soundscape melded with dream imagery and mental
fusion" Vav Jungle is the brain child of Canadian musician Eve Rice.
After a couple of years of performances and experimentation the debut
CD Zig-a-dig was released in 1997, featuring Eve along with a host of
guest musicians. Vav Jungle's mixture of lounge, easy listening, disco
and quirky lyrics works pretty well most of the time.
One moment the synthesizer backings remind you of 1980s new wave, the
next moment you think you're listening to Japanese pop from the late
90s, but all along there is a very pleasant "retro-kitsch" feel - and
we mean that in the most positive way!
